If your Chromebook supports Play Store apps, you can access Android files using the Chrome OS Files app. In this article, we will explore these options in detail.
View Android Files on Chromebook
To access Android files on Chromebook:
- Open the Files app.
- Click and expand My Files from the left-pane.
- Click Play files.
- You should now see Movies, Pictures, and Music folders from Android on your Chromebook.
Show all Play Folders on Chromebook
By default the Files app only shows the following three folders:
- Movies
- Pictures
- Music.
You can, however, view all the Play files and folders by selecting Show all Play folders from the settings menu. You will also see the “Show hidden files” option here.
